28.53332324 77.2803756

Tata Motors Cars Service Centre - Treo, Okhla Industrial Area

Review Us

  • 4.4
  • saurav dey
    Posted on: 21-09-2025
    Rated
    • 4

    Good service experience. Good hospitality

  • Madhusudan Suman
    Posted on: 10-09-2025
    Rated
    • 5

    (Translated by Google) Tata Motors Workshop (Original) टाटा मोटर्स वर्कशॉप

Gallery

Nearby TATA Motors Dealers

Tata Motors Cars Service Centre - Treo, Mohan Co Operative Industrial Estate

Mohan Co Operative Industrial Estate

New Delhi - 110044

Service

Tata Motors Cars Showroom - Jasper Industries, Okhla

Okhla Industrial Area

New Delhi - 110020

Service

Tata Motors Cars Showroom - SAB Motors, Mathura Road

Mathura Road

South Delhi - 110044

Showroom
Service

Tata Motors Cars Showroom - SAB Motors, Lajpat Nagar

Lajpat Nagar

South Delhi - 110024

Showroom
Showroom
Service
Showroom